What Is a Trailer Kit?

A trailer kit is a pre-packaged set of tie-downs, ratchet straps, hooks, and accessories designed to help secure loads on trailers efficiently. Instead of purchasing separate straps and components, a kit provides a complete, ready-to-use system that ensures compatibility and reliability.

Trailer kits come in different sizes, strengths, and configurations, catering to various transport needs—from light-duty weekend hauls to heavy-duty commercial transport.

What’s Included in a Trailer Kit?

While trailer kits can vary based on brand and purpose, most high-quality kits include these key components:

1. Ratchet Tie-Down Straps

 ✅ Heavy-duty polyester or nylon webbing for superior strength and minimal stretch.
Ratchet mechanisms for easy tensioning and a rock-solid hold.
✅ Available in different widths (typically 1.5-inch or 2-inch straps).
High Working Load Limits (WLL) rated to withstand thousands of pounds.

2. Soft-Tye Loops

 ✅ Protects painted surfaces, handlebars, or delicate parts from scratches.
✅ Provides an alternative connection point for versatility.
✅ Ideal for motorcycles, ATVs, and UTVs.
✅ Prevents metal-on-metal contact, reducing wear and tear.

3. Heavy-Duty Hooks

 ✅ Latching snap hooks, carabiner hooks, or flat hooks for different anchor points.
✅ Prevents accidental disengagement while on the road.
✅ Made from zinc-coated or stainless steel for corrosion resistance.
✅ Ensures a secure and reliable hold even in extreme conditions.

4. Storage Bag or Carrying Case

 ✅ Keeps all components organized and easy to transport.
✅ Protects straps from dirt, UV exposure, and moisture when not in use.
✅ Prevents losing or misplacing essential tie-downs.
✅ Some kits include water-resistant or reinforced storage cases for added durability.

5. Optional Accessories (Varies by Kit)

  • E-Track or Aero-Track fittings for easy trailer mounting.

  • Wheel chocks or adjustable wheel nets for extra security.

  • Protective ratchet covers to shield ratchets from weather and debris.

  • Extra anchor points or mounting brackets for custom setups.

How to Choose the Right Trailer Kit for Your Needs

When selecting a trailer kit, consider these key factors:

1. Load Capacity & Working Load Limit (WLL)

  • Ensure the kit’s components match or exceed the weight of your cargo.

  • Light-duty kits: 1,500 – 3,000 lbs. WLL (motorcycles, ATVs, small loads).

  • Heavy-duty kits: 3,000 – 6,000+ lbs. WLL (UTVs, larger vehicles, equipment).

2. Strap Width & Strength

  • 1.5-inch straps – Great for motorcycles and lightweight UTVs.

  • 2-inch straps – Best for hauling heavier vehicles and off-road rigs.

  • Wider straps distribute force more evenly, reducing strain on tie-down points.

3. Hook Style & Attachment Points

  • Carabiner hooks – Locking security for extreme conditions.

  • Latching snap hooks – Prevent accidental strap disengagement.

  • Flat hooks or E-Track fittings – Best for trailers with built-in anchor systems.

4. Weather Resistance

  • Look for water-resistant and UV-protected webbing to extend lifespan.

  • Zinc-coated or stainless steel hardware prevents rust and corrosion.

5. Extra Accessories for Customization

  • Some kits include wheel nets, protective ratchet covers, or extra tie-down points.

  • Consider what additional features might make your hauling experience easier.
